Overview

The Terasic Spider is a six-legged walking robot which is driven with 18 servo motors. These 18 servo motors are controlled by PWM signals generated from the Altera DE0-Nano-SoC board embedded inside the Terasic Spider. The Terasic Spider itself can be remotely controlled by a bluetooth enabled Android device. The software app that we developed can control the Terasic Spider to move in four directions, swing based on the g-sensor data, and even complete a dance with pre-defined movements.

All the source codes of the Terasic Spider is available with the kit. You can modify the code to improve or to change the Terasic Spider's functions according to specific applications. The source codes include Android project, Linux application project, and a Quartus project.

Note that there is a 2x20 GPIO expansion header available on the DE0-Nano-SoC board. You are free to use it to expand functions, such as camera, ultrasonic, or anything else.


Specification

Spider Specification

  • DE0-Nano-SoC Altera SoC FPGA board for the spider control
  • Servo Motor Card for servo motor driving
  • Metal gear servo motor - MG996R
  • Aluminum body
  • Remote control through bluetooth
  • Power from 12V DC or Battery
  • Open Source

Servo Motor Card Features:

  • 2X20 3.3V GPIO Interface
  • Drive 24 servo motors at most
  • Fuse protection for each servo driving port
  • Build-In Altera CPLD and Power Monitor Chip:
    • Battery voltage monitor
    • Total current monitor
    • Auto shutdown when battery is low or total current is too high.
    • P.S. Source code is available for users to modify according to their application.
